The debate over the brown bear in the Pyrenees has long focused on population figures, livestock losses, range expansion and coexistence with mountain farming. A new element is now entering that discussion: the possibility of identifying individual bears through facial recognition applied to images and video recorded in the wild.
According to Le Chasseur Français, brown bears in the Pyrenees could soon be identified from facial traits using a system inspired by the BearID project, an international initiative that applies artificial intelligence to individual bear recognition.
From counting bears to identifying individuals
The distinction matters. Traditional bear monitoring relies on signs of presence, camera traps, sightings, tracks and genetic analysis. Automated facial identification would not necessarily replace those methods, but it could complement fieldwork where enough high-quality images are available.
The BearID project presents itself as a machine-learning tool designed to identify individual bears from images and videos. Its aim is to support new non-invasive census and monitoring techniques for wild bears, particularly through remote cameras. The scientific basis of the system has been described in research on automated identification of brown bears using facial images.
For a species without obvious markings such as stripes or spots, identifying individuals can be especially difficult for non-specialists. AI systems look for stable patterns in the animal’s face, including the geometry between the eyes, muzzle and other facial reference points. Their usefulness will depend on image quality, model training and validation against established monitoring methods.
A sensitive Pyrenean context
The development comes at a time when brown bear monitoring in the Pyrenean range already depends on a cross-border technical framework. The Réseau Ours Brun, coordinated in France by the Office français de la biodiversité, recorded 3,287 indirect signs in 2025, of which 801 were submitted for genetic analysis, according to the annual report published in 2026.
Another report by the Office français de la biodiversité on damage assessments between 2019 and 2025 states that, in confirmed predation cases in France, the individuals involved were identified in 17.3% of cases. The same document warns of sampling bias and of the difficulty of interpreting an individual bear’s predatory behaviour solely from genetic detections.
